
During October 2025, Tathagata Srimani enhanced the tathagatasrimani/codesign repository by developing alpha scaling features for dynamic layout density in OpenRoad runs, enabling proportional scaling of design parameters such as track pitches, LEFs, and die area across technology nodes. Using Python and Tcl, Tathagata extended the configuration management system to support these scaling capabilities and updated submodule references to maintain build consistency with external dependencies. The work also introduced PolyBench-based Vitis kernel benchmarks, improving performance evaluation readiness. This engineering effort deepened the stack’s scalability, benchmarking, and maintainability, reflecting a strong grasp of backend development and EDA tool integration.
